Segurança em nível de usuário

Definição - o que significa segurança em nível de usuário?

A segurança no nível do usuário no contexto do Access da Microsoft é um nível refinado de restrições e permissões para o usuário do banco de dados.

A segurança em nível de usuário permite que o administrador do banco de dados agrupe usuários com necessidades semelhantes em pools comuns chamados grupos de trabalho. As permissões podem então ser concedidas ao grupo de trabalho em vez de a usuários individuais, facilitando a administração de permissões. Dois grupos padrão são fornecidos, o grupo Admins e o grupo Usuários.

Definirtec explica a segurança no nível do usuário

O Microsoft Access usa um mecanismo de banco de dados denominado Jet. Antes do Access 2007, todos os dados eram armazenados em um arquivo .mdb. O mecanismo Jet controla todo o acesso a qualquer objeto contido no arquivo .mdb. Não importa como um usuário acessa os dados (por meio de um aplicativo front-end ou da interface de linha de comando) porque as permissões definidas pelo Jet serão sempre as mesmas.

A segurança em nível de usuário oferece um nível muito refinado de detalhes na atribuição de permissões. Por exemplo, pode ser definido que o grupo de trabalho Admins pode ler, editar e excluir dados da tabela Customer_Master. Aqueles no grupo de trabalho Gerentes podem visualizar e editar dados na mesma tabela, mas não excluí-los. Os membros do grupo Funcionários só podem visualizar os dados da tabela.

Esta definição foi escrita no contexto do Microsoft Access